8 hours ago, Reagan said:
Not sure I would agree with this. But, it's mere speculation on both our parts. Let's take Aledo, they are playing in the second straight Sate Championship. Do you think they have better athletes than Nederland or Port Neches? Or is it coaching? Back went Art Briles was at Stephenville, he won, what, 4 State titles?! They've been decent since but not what Briles achieved. Briles goes to Baylor and has a massive turn-a-round. He leaves and they got to S**t! Think back to the Gordon Woods at Brownwood (6 Titles) and G.A. Moore at Celina (5 Titles), you think these people always had the talent? Or was the athlete coached to get them were they needed to be? A lot of times coaches will use the "we don't have the talent" excuse to cover for their failings. By the way, in the 70's, you think PN-G had the overall talent to win as much as they did? Or was it Doug Ethridge, the coach?
If you were at the Manvel vs. NEDERLAND game, you might have a better perspective. NEDERLAND was outmanned at 90% of the positions and were within 10 heading to the 4th qtr. Thats kids playing extremely hard, believing because of their confidence in the program, and coaches coaching out of their minds to give the kids a chance. I don't know if there's a coach on the planet that could've taken the Nederland kids and beaten Manvel or George Ranch. It feels good to tyoe it on a messageboard, but reality is in the other corner.
